• <br />• <br />• <br />Planning & Zoning Board <br />November 12, 1998 <br />Page 13 <br />Mr. Dunn asked if the impact of the proposed Comprehensive Plan has been discussed <br />with the applicants. Ms. Wyland indicated she has discussed the proposed <br />Comprehensive Plan with the applicant. The applicants are not concerned regarding the <br />Comprehensive Plan. <br />Mr. Dunn asked about the potential for subdividing the property. Ms. Wyland stated that <br />if the Comprehensive Plan is adopted the area is shown for development after 2010. The <br />property could be subdivided at that time if City sewer and water is available. The <br />applicants understand the implications of the proposed Comprehensive Plan. <br />Mr. Corson asked if there are wells on the property. Ms. Wyland indicated that issue has <br />not been addressed. <br />Mr. and Mrs. Houle, 707 Harriet in Shoreview, came forward and stated they are okay <br />with staff recommended conditions. Mr. Houle stated the house already has a new roof. <br />They will be removing the roof and adding head room and will reinsulate. They are <br />trying to restore the house. New trusses will be added also. <br />Mr. Corson questioned the right of access from the County. Mr. Houle stated he is not <br />concerned about the County turning them down. He stated there are no wells on the <br />property. Access will be on the east side of the home. <br />Mr. Dunn asked if the applicants will live on the property. Mr. Houle indicated they will <br />be living in the home on the property. <br />Mr. Powell stated the approval is contingent on the County granting access to Birch <br />Street. He indicated he believes the County will approve the right of access. <br />Mr. Dunn asked if the applicants are okay with two buildings concurrent. Mr. Houle <br />indicated that is not a problem. He stated he has had a hard time finding someone to <br />move the house. <br />Mr. Robinson noted that traditionally the County has allowed one access per 40 acres. <br />Formal application has to be made to the County. <br />Mr. Dunn made a MOTION to approve the Dennis & Martha Houle Site Plan Review to <br />allow the relocation of a single family home onto the property at the south/west corner of <br />Birch Street and Centerville Road, with the following conditions: <br />1. Property building permits are obtained for all construction and the home is located to <br />as to conform to all City rules and regulation and the Uniform Building Code. <br />2. The applicant connect to City Water which is available on Birch Street. <br />
